#d41286 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d41286 is composed of 83.1% red, 7.1% green and 52.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 91.5% magenta, 36.8%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 324.1 degrees, a saturation of 84.3% and a lightness of 45.1%. #d41286 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ff24ff with #a9000d. Closest websafe color is: #cc0099.

Shades and Tints of #d41286

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0108 is the darkest color, while #fffaf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#d41286

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c6a75 is the less saturated color, while #e60089 is the most saturated one.
